Subject: DR drill — Trailmark offline mode

Maintainers: Thursday's drill simulates total sync loss for the Trailmark field-survey app. Surveyors will work offline for four hours, then we restore the Kestrel sync service from cold backup. Verify local queues flush in order and no records drop. Document any conflicts in the drill log. Keep the restore scripts untouched until after the debrief. To decrypt the cold backup during the restore step, use the recovery passphrase below.

vault phrase of tajop-haduf = holath-brivan-wenax

Subject: Handover — DocTidy release duties

Hi all, I'm passing DocTidy linter releases to the incoming rotation. Builds run weekly from the main branch; tag, let CI produce the package, then sign and publish to the internal registry. The style-rule updates ship separately, so don't bundle them. Everything else is in the runbook. The signing key you'll need for publishing is below.

rollout seal: bky4_x7Gc

Handover — Landlord Site Audit, Fenholt Yard

Marla: Greywick Estates audit is Thursday morning. New starters, stay clear of the loading bay until they're done. Fire registers are updated; riser cupboards unlocked at 8. Escort the assessor at all times — don't leave them on a floor alone. They'll need the service corridor; the pass code for that door follows.

staff pass of kawip-hawef = bdg-QLP-2